Class D IP addresses range from 224.0.0.0 to 239.255.255.255. For details, see
Table 142.

As specified by IANA, the IP addresses ranging from 224.0.0.0 to 224.0.0.255 are
reserved for network protocols on local networks. Table 143 lists commonly used
reserved IP multicast addresses:

Like having reserved the private network segment 10.0.0.0/8 for unicast, IANA has
also reserved the network segment 239.0.0.0/8 for multicast. These are
administratively scoped addresses. With the administratively scoped addresses,
you can define the range of multicast domains flexibly to isolate IP addresses
between different multicast domains, so that the same multicast address can be
used in different multicast domains without causing collisions.
